> What she does at school is really up to the teacher there. Lots of
> schools begin band instrument lessons in 4th grade and strings even
> earlier. In many cases a 5th grade start is based more on economics
> (fewer teachers are needed) than pedagogy. If she's ready now, never
> mind what is permitted in the local school.
